
Starcof Syrup
Marketer
Starzac Formulations
Salt Composition
Ambroxol (15mg/5ml) + Guaifenesin (50mg/5ml) + Menthol (0.5mg/5ml) + Terbutaline (1.25mg/5ml)
Overview Starcof Syrup
Cough relief is provided by the expectorant Starcof Syrup, a multi-ingredient formulation. It facilitates mucus clearance from the respiratory tract by reducing its viscosity, easing expectoration. The syrup also soothes throat discomfort and offers a cooling effect. Starcof Syrup's dosage and treatment duration should strictly adhere to your physician's instructions, with or without food. Dosage adjustments depend on individual responses and health status. Complete the prescribed course; premature cessation may lead to symptom recurrence and condition exacerbation. Disclose all other medications to your doctor, as interactions are possible. Common side effects include nausea, diarrhea, vomiting, gastrointestinal upset, headache, skin rash, tremors, and tachycardia. These are often transient and self-limiting. Report any concerning side effects immediately. Drowsiness is a potential effect; avoid driving or activities requiring alertness until its impact is known. Alcohol should be avoided due to increased drowsiness risk. Self-medication and recommending this medication to others are strongly discouraged. Adequate hydration is recommended. Inform your doctor of pregnancy, pregnancy plans, or breastfeeding before commencing treatment.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Alcohol consumption alongside Starcof Syrup may pose unknown risks. Seek medical advice before combining them.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Starcof Syrup during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ible risks prior to prescription. Consult your doctor for adv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data on Starcof Syrup's compatibility with breastfeeding is absent. Seek medical advice from your physician.
Driving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The effect of Starcof Syrup on driving ability is undetermined. Refrain from driving if you develop symptoms impairing concentration or reaction time.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Use of Starcof Syrup in individuals with kidney impairment appears to pose minimal risk. Existing ev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ary, however, physician consultation is recommended.
Li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Starcof Syrup's use in patients with liver disease appears to pose minimal risk. Existing ev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ary, but physician consultation is recommended.
